22 Best colleges for Radiology and Nuclear medicine in Virginia
Updated:
Below is a list of best universities in Virginia ranked based on their research performance in Radiology and Nuclear medicine. A graph of 1.41M citations received by 45.9K academic papers made by 22 universities in Virginia was used to calculate publications' ratings, which then were adjusted for release dates and added to final scores.
We don't distinguish between undergraduate and graduate programs nor do we adjust for current majors offered. You can find information about granted degrees on a university page but always double-check with the university website.
